Sendoffs 2009
What a Successful Sendoff Season!
All through July and August, Lehigh University opened its arms to the Class of 2009. Sendoffs were held in over 25 locations from Southern California and the Rocky Mountains to Chicago and Vermont! Many incoming students and their families were welcomed into the homes of alumni, which gave them an even greater Lehigh family feel. Attendance at these events was at an all time high of over 1,300 alumni, incoming students and families.
Each Sendoff was a great opportunity for incoming students and parents to meet and mingle with current undergraduates, alumni, faculty and staff. You could feel the excitement and anticipation about the first days at Lehigh! The personal stories and fond memories of everyone at these events let our newest members know that they were about to embark on the greatest years of their lives and begin their life-long relationship with the Lehigh family!

Club Spotlight
The Lehigh Club of the Twin Cities
(Minneapolis/St. Paul)
The Lehigh Club of the Twin Cities has sky-rocketed to one of the most successful Alumni Clubs in the country. From Happy Hours and Baseball Games to Lehigh/Lafayette Telecasts and Sendoffs, the Twin Cities has made their mark in the Alumni Clubs world.
They held their first Freshmen Sendoff this summer on July 23rd, where they welcomed 9 incoming student from the area. The event was held at the home of Jeff ‘77 and Joan Wright and there were over 35 people in attendance! The club was also excited to welcome Lehigh’s Director of Alumni Clubs, Jill Anderson ’91, to the event. The Club’s President, David Yussen ‘99 said, “The visit raised awareness that the school is really behind us, and made a strong impression on the families in attendance.” It was a huge triumph and can only mean that there will be greater events in the future.
Other fabulous Club events have been the annual Lehigh-Lafayette Telecast, a Happy Hour at a local Irish Pub, a Picnic and Concert at Lake Harriet Bandshell and a Groundhog Day celebration. Through these events, they have watched attendance grow in leaps and bounds by seeing a wide range of alumni, in terms of class year (from the ‘60s to the‘05s), come out in support of their Alma Mater.
Their success is due in large part to its dedicated president, David Yussen ‘99. David moved to Minneapolis in December of 2000, after living and working in Philadelphia for a couple years. He was an avid fan of the Lehigh-Lafayette games, having never missed one since 1995, so his first initiative when he arrived in the Twin Cities was to jump-start the local Lehigh-Lafayette telecast event.
David attributes this past year’s success to a slow but steady growth in awareness and the continuity of holding events every several months, for several years. “It gave people the opportunity to get to know one another, without feeling that involvement requires a heavy commitment” he said. Some of David’s long-term goals are to build the alumni membership and participation, continue to partner with Admissions to increase local awareness and support recruiting, and set up a forum (bulletin board or mailing list) for Club members to interact in between events.
This Club is unique in the sense that they are very far from the university, 1,200 miles to be exact, so trips back to South Mountain are not always feasible. David said that he finds the alumni in the area to hold as much pride and enthusiasm for Lehigh as do those in Northern NJ, NY or PA. In fact, many of Club’s members are East Coast natives. “While there are seemingly unlimited possibilities for events, including live professional sports, music, theater, or museums, the geographic dispersion of its members makes it difficult to accommodate everyone” he said. But, is a challenge the Club is eager to take on with programs reflecting the interests of the alumni.
The Club is excited and ready for another eventful year! Some of the activities coming up are the 2005 Lehigh-Lafayette broadcast, which will be held at Champps Americana in downtown Minneapolis. Following that, there will be a winter event after the holidays and for next summer, they are planning a family outing to tailgate and watch the minor league team, the St. Paul Saints.
